The decomposition of ozone on a Cu(l10) surface has been studied using AM1 method. O3 probably adsorbs on Cu(l10) to decompose into a molecular oxygen and an adsorbed atomic oxygen species, an adsorbed atomic oxygen reacts with O3 to form an O4 -intermediate, and O4 - decomposes into two oxygen molecules.
